Always Cover The Water Tank Lids For Protection

Algae thrive in sunlight, which fuels their rapid growth through photosynthesis. One of the simplest ways to control algae naturally is to block out that sunlight. Use opaque lids for water tanks and install shade nets or floating covers for ponds. By reducing direct light exposure, you can automatically limit algae’s ability to grow and spread.

Maintain a Regular Cleaning Routine

Organic debris, like leaves and dirt, creates the perfect breeding ground for algae. That’s why regular cleaning is key. Scrub the inner walls of your tank or pond, clear out any rotting matter, and rinse thoroughly with clean water. Doing this every month can dramatically reduce algae buildup and improve overall water quality.

Introduce Natural Algae Eaters

If you have a pond, then you have mother nature on your side, and bringing in fish that eat algae as a part of their diet will create a natural way to keep your pond looking good. Some fish to look for are Siamese algae eaters, swimming mollies, and some types of snails. As with the above two options, you need to source the right species compatible with your plants as well as the wildlife in the body of water prior to making your decision.

Use Barley Straw or Extract

Barley straw has been around for some time and is a known natural algae control mechanism for ponds. As barley straw breaks down in water, it releases compounds that help control algae growth. If you want to avoid doing weed control, you can lose barley straws in mesh bags and float them in your pond. You can also use a liquid barley extract for a quicker solution. Barley straw is harmless to fish and plants in ponds and is a gentle way to control the algae population over time. Improve Water Movement

Stagnant water and slow movement are perfect growing conditions for algae. If you are able to increase the water movement or circulation in your pond or tank, then it will make it difficult for algae to settle and expand. If you have a pond, consider a solar-powered fountain or solar-powered aerator. If you have a tank, make sure the inflow and outflow of water are effective to ensure movement throughout your setting.
